  • One Connect and dimming awning lights?

    My 337rls has the One Connect system. The awning lights are on the One Connect system. That effectively makes my awning lights on a three way switch with the One Connect and the manual control panel. Wondering if I dropped my awning lights from the One Connect system could I then install a dimmer at my manual control panel like I did with my Imagine trailer?

    I don't care if my awning lights are no longer One Connect controllable what I do care about is being able to dim my awning lights.

    Theoretically--absolutely. Easily? Maybe.

    The old setup (like on my trailer) uses the switch to interrupt (or pass) +12v. Your trailer uses the panel switch to send a signal (ground?) to the Unity board to tell it to turn on (or off) the light). So the questions are:

    1) Can the existing wire from the panel switch be repurposed to pass power? In other words, is the wire a gauge that matches the output side of the Unity board's wiring to the light?

    2) Where does the "signal" from the Unity board originate and can it be terminated easily behind the Convenience Center. Note this is not a CANBUS line on the Reflection like it would be on a Solitude, Momentum, or even an Imagine. (That's a good thing for what you want to do.)

    3) Where would power be tapped from for this circuit? (Maybe a new wire off the Power Distribution Center, with it's own fuse, to the switch? There's normally plenty of open, unused taps on the board.)

    It's definitely possible, but how is not known since no one has successfully completed this mod (or hasn't documented it for the rest of us).

      ckreef Thus far what I have seen in my Reflection wiring is it is all the same size. Thus it SHOULD be possible to convert from the Unity control to switch control.

      From what I have seen the unity board uses a state change to determine if it should turn the lights on or off since you can control the light from your phone, the touch screen, or the manual switch. You would need to find the trigger wire at the unity board and the power out wire to the lights. I.E. turn lights on with panel switch and it supplies 12V to the unity board, turn off lights with phone but hard switch is still supplying power to the unity board turn off switch killing 12V to the board and lights come back on.

      Now for the complicated part. Since the panel is only suppling a voltage signal to the board there is little to no amperage in the wiring from the control panel to the board. If you look at the unity board, there is a large set of power wires that come in from the battery to feed all of the various things controlled by the board.

                I installed a remote dimmer between the output of the one control board and the lights. Used a remote dimmer because the one control board is in the basement. Put the remote control in the command center. Worked great. Link to remote dimmer unit:
